George Markos knows firsthand how exceptional Mass General Brigham’s heart and vascular care is.

In honor of that lifesaving experience, George and his wife, Jill, became active annual donors. And later, when it was time to review their estate plans, they included a gift in their will, extending their commitment to the hospital for future generations.

It all began several years ago when George took a quick run up the stairs at work. His breathing soon returned to normal, but his pulse did not. On his way home that evening, he stopped at a local hospital on the North Shore to get checked out, thinking it would be a quick visit. Instead, he was admitted.

After five days in the hospital, George’s heart rate still wasn’t under control. Jill insisted he transfer to Brigham and Women’s Hospital, now part of Mass General Brigham, where doctors adjusted his medications and performed a cardioversion — a medical procedure that uses quick, low-energy shocks — to restore his regular heartbeat. A few years later, George’s cardiologist — who is now part of the Mass General Brigham Heart and Vascular Institute — recommended a cardiac ablation to help prevent future irregular heart rhythms.

In the years since this experience, George has continued receiving routine cardiac care at the Heart and Vascular Institute. He says he feels like “a million bucks” and has resumed his active lifestyle, including kickboxing, hiking with Jill, and spending time with his five grandchildren.

Those cherished moments with family, especially their grandchildren, are part of what inspired George and Jill to create a legacy gift. As George puts it, “I want to make sure Mass General Brigham is here for them, too — and for everyone who needs it.”

The Markoses designated their bequest as an unrestricted gift to provide flexible support to meet the most urgent priorities and promising opportunities — a thoughtful way to unlock progress for generations to come. 

“My cardiac care has made an incredible difference in my life — they really are the best in the world,” George says. “And, throughout it all, everyone has been so comforting and caring.”
